Handover: request tracing across the Coppervale microservices mesh. Plugin authors must propagate the trace header on every outbound hop; dropping it breaks span stitching in the Nightjar collector. Sampling config lives in the gateway, not per-service — don't override it. Known gap: async job spans are orphaned; fix is queued. All tracing SDK questions, header spec changes, and plugin certification issues now route to the owner below.

approver of tagef-hawef = Oliok Julath

Subject: Tollbrook Term Sheet — Board Review

Board,

Tollbrook Dynamics delivered their term sheet Friday. Headline: minority stake, board observer seat, exclusivity in the Averlane market for three years. Valuation is acceptable; exclusivity clause is not. Counsel is drafting a counter. We need board sign-off before Thursday's call. The confidential negotiating position is set out below.

confidential, yajof-fawep: The renewal with Quenaelax Holdings closes at $20 million a year, 20 percent above the last contract. Project Holix slips by two quarters because of the staffing delay.

Step 4: Enable dark mode for the Marrowgate admin dashboard. Before deploying, verify the theme bundle built correctly by running `npm run verify:themes`; you should see both `light.css` and `dark.css` listed in the output. Next, open the deploy environment file at `deploy/.env.production`. Set `MARROWGATE_THEME_DEFAULT=system` so the dashboard respects each admin's OS preference, and set `MARROWGATE_THEME_CACHE=true` to avoid refetching palettes per session. Immediately after those two lines, add the theme service credential:

vault entry, yahif-yajep: COURIER_KEY29=b802bdf8034096b65a51c6ba5abe2